Iga Swiatek and Barbora Krejcikova will take on each other in the final of the 2023 WTA Dubai Open on February 25.
The Dubai Tennis Championships’ championship match pits top seed Iga Swiatek against Barbora Krejcikova on Saturday. After successfully defending her title at the Qatar Open, Swiatek entered the competition and was given a bye into the second round. In order to advance to the quarterfinals, she first defeated Leylah Fernandez 6-1, 6-1 before crushing Liudmila Samsonova, the 14th seed, 6-1, 6-0. Karolina Pliskova was supposed to face Swiatek in the round of eight, but the Czech withdrew due to illness, giving the top-ranked player a walkover to the semifinals. She won this match against Coco Gauff 6-4, 6-2 to advance to her second straight final.
Barbora Krejcikova has had a fantastic run in Dubai, and this competition might be just what the Czech player needs to return to her top form on the singles circuit. The 27-year-old began the WTA 1000 tournament by defeating Irina-Camelia Begu 6-4, 6-2, and then defeated seventh-seeded Daria Kasatkina 6-4, 4-6, 7-5 in three sets of fierce competition. In the third round, Krejcikova defeated fellow countrywoman Petra Kvitova 6-3, 6-2 to advance to the quarterfinals. Here, despite being trounced in the first set, she pulled off a major upset by inflicting Aryna Sabalenka, the Australian Open champion, with her first loss of the 2023 campaign.
In the semifinal match against third-seeded Jessica Pegula, the 2021 French Open champion easily won the first set, 6-1. The American, however, recovered in the second and won it 7-5 to send the game to a decider. To advance to her second WTA 1000 final, Krejcikova dominated the decisive set and won it 6-0. It’s interesting to note that she won her first match at the Dubai Tennis Championships in 2021.

Swiatek leads Krejcikova 2-1 in their head-to-head meetings, but the Czech won their most recent encounter 5-7, 7-6(4), 6-3 in the 2017 AGEL Open final in Ostrava.
